#3123e0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#3123e0 is composed of 19.2% red, 13.7% green and 87.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.1% cyan, 84.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 244.4 degrees, a saturation of 75.3% and a lightness of 50.8%. #3123e0 color hex could be obtained by blending #6246ff with #0000c1. Closest websafe color is: #3333cc.

Shades and Tints of #3123e0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010004 is the darkest color, while #f2f1fd is the lightest one.
